What SEO spam looks like

Attackers inject hidden pages, redirects, or link blocks into your site — usually targeting pharmaceutical keywords, gambling, or counterfeit goods. The content is invisible to your visitors but visible to Google. Your search results start showing spam, your rankings drop, and you may not realize anything is wrong for weeks.

Common patterns

  • Pharma hack — hidden pages selling counterfeit medications
  • Japanese SEO spam — Japanese-language pages and search results
  • Cloaked redirects — visitors from Google get redirected; direct visitors do not
  • Hidden link injection — links to spam sites added to your existing pages
  • Sitemap poisoning — your sitemap.xml modified to list spam pages

How we restore

We identify and remove all injected content from files and database, regenerate clean sitemaps, submit Google reindex requests, and harden the site against the entry point — usually a vulnerable plugin or a compromised admin account.

Full recovery typically takes 1-2 weeks of cumulative work between cleanup, reindex requests, and rankings stabilizing.

What we identify and remove

Pharma hack

Hidden pages selling counterfeit medications, usually targeting Cialis/Viagra keywords. Often invisible to admins because the spam pages are only served to Googlebot.

Japanese SEO spam

Japanese-language pages and search results appearing for your site. Almost always indicates a deep compromise of WordPress core or a critical plugin.

Cloaked redirects

Visitors from Google search get redirected to spam; direct visitors see your normal site. Designed to hide the compromise from the site owner.

Hidden link injection

Links to spam sites added to your existing pages, usually with CSS that hides them visually. Damages your site’s SEO over time.

Sitemap poisoning

Your sitemap.xml modified to list hundreds of spam URLs, accelerating their indexing by search engines.
